Big Boi Announces 'Boomiverse' Release Date

Still booming off his “Mic Jack” and “Kill Jill” singles, Big Boi has announced a release date for his upcoming third album, Boomiverse, which is due June 16.

To celebrate the announcement, the OutKast MC is performing “Mic Jack” on “The Voice” with one of the show’s judges, Adam Levine, this evening (May 16). Plus, fans will be able to Shazam the performance in order to unlock the exclusive premiere of the song’s video.

A preview to the visual, set at a dry-cleaners, is out now.

Just last month, Big Boi performed his new single on “The Tonight Show” with Sleepy Brown in Levine’s place.

Boomiverse, Big Boi’s third album and first since 2012’s Vicious Lies and Dangerous Rumors, is also set to feature Killer Mike, Jeezy, Gucci Mane, CeeLo Green, and Pimp C, with production by Dr. Luke, Scott Storch, DJ Dahi, and Organized Noize.
